Between 1969 and 1972, Breuer and his partner Herbert Beckhard produced drawings for a public high school in Long Island City, Queens. The long building anchored horizontal expanses of modular precast concrete window panels in rectilinear volumes of windowless textured concrete block. The architects used these contrasting materials in combination with projecting and receding surfaces and variations in height to counteract the monumental massing of the building and add visual interest to the composition. Despite the fact that construction drawings exist at Syracuse University, the school was never built.
